MEMO — Kettling Depot Receiving

Uniform sets for the new Kettling depot arrive Wednesday via Ashgrove courier: 40 boxes, sorted by size, manifest attached to box one. Check the count at the dock before signing; shortages go straight to stores, not the courier. The hand-over instruction the courier will follow is set out below.

drop instructions, tafof-baguf: the holmir gilox courier leaves the sormir ulaok holdor ledger at gate 5596 under passcode 257343

Handover: Tilecrest cache layer. Owner moving from me to Dray's team Monday. Known issues: eviction spikes at zoom 14+, and the warmup job double-counts hits after restarts. Don't restart both cache nodes at once — renders go blank for ~4 min. Logs are verbose; filter on the cache-miss tag. Support should only touch TTLs, nothing else. Current production settings are listed below for reference.

service settings:
PRAIX_LOG_LEVEL=error
PRAIX_METRICS_HOST=metrics.praix.qorvelcorp.corp
PRAIX_POOL_SIZE=16

# Heads-up for folks new to the Larkbuild migration: we are moving the
# Quillstone pipeline to a fully hermetic build system, so nothing may be
# fetched implicitly at compile time. Every input, toolchain, and cache
# endpoint must be declared here explicitly. Review each entry before
# changing it, since hermetic builds fail loudly on drift. The fetcher's
# signing secret goes on the line below.

sealed setting: VAULT_KEY20=c8ea1e419912889df6b4